On-campus student employment instructions

Step 1: Complete an Application for Student Employment by printing it from here and send it to:

Career Center
Barton County Community College
245 NE 30 Rd.
Great Bend, Kansas 67530
or obtain an application in the Career Center or the Office of Human Resources.
Please review the Student Employment Eligibility Criteria.

Step 2: Once your application is received, please review the open positions posted below. Check back often as job postings change frequently.

Step 3: To apply for a position, click on the link posted with the position. A request form will open for you to complete and submit. Upon receipt, your application will be sent to the department with an opening.

Step 4: Supervisors will review applications and select their employees.
